A Coin Forged in National Grief
The Kennedy Half Dollar was born from tragedy, first minted in 1964 just months after President John F. Kennedy’s assassination. The U.S. Mint moved swiftly to honor the fallen leader, replacing the Benjamin Franklin Half Dollar with a new design bearing Kennedy’s portrait. When released in March 1964, the coin immediately became a national keepsake – both circulating currency and memorial tribute.
